Software Engineer(Internship) applicants have rated the interview process at Amazon with 3.3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 57.8%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Software Engineer(Internship) roles take an average of 16 days to get hired, when considering 3 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Amazon overall takes an average of 27 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Amazon as a Software Engineer(Internship) according to 3 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 67%
One on one interview: 33%

Resume submitted. Got OA after 3 months. OA has a part with coding questions and a second part with Leadership Principles questions. Passed all test cases for the coding questions. Rejected within the same week.

Very straight foward, study star principles, and leetcode but coding just on note pad and interviewer just tells you the question word by word so that makes it a little more difficult. No test cases or anything just ask you and you code on notepad.
